If the 2025-26 Serie A season is cancelled, postponed after May 31, 2026, 11:59 PM ET, or there is otherwise no official leader declared within that timeframe, this market will resolve to “Other” The primary resolution source will be official statistics from the Serie A (https://en.legaseriea.it/serie-a/statistiche/giocatori); however, a consensus of credible reporting may also be used.Federico Dimarco's dominant 95.5% implied probability in the Serie A most assists market stems from his commanding lead with 14 assists after 28 matchdays, far ahead of challengers like Nicolò Barella and Armand Laurienté at seven each, reflecting Inter Milan's title-contending attack that maximizes his crossing and set-piece prowess as a left-back. Recent milestones, including a defender-record nine assists by mid-season and nearing Papu Gómez's single-campaign mark of 16, have solidified trader consensus amid consistent starts and no reported injury concerns. Upsets remain possible via Dimarco absence through injury or suspension, or a prolific remaining schedule surge from pursuits like Jesús Rodríguez or Kenan Yildiz, though Inter's fixture edge limits such scenarios.
